Kinds Of Coffee Machines
Choosing the best coffee machine depends upon personal preferences, budget plan, and brewing style. Here's a breakdown of the most typical kinds of coffee makers available:
| Type of Machine | Description | Suitable For |
|---|---|---|
| Drip Coffee Maker | Brews big amounts of coffee by dripping warm water over coffee premises. | Families or coffee drinkers who prefer several cups at a time. |
| Single-Serve Coffee Maker | Uses pods or pills for single portions of coffee. | Individuals who desire benefit and quick cups. |
| Espresso Machine | Brews focused coffee by requiring warm water through finely-ground coffee. | Espresso enthusiasts and those who take pleasure in coffee beverages like lattes and cappuccinos. |
| French Press | Immerses coffee grounds in hot water, then separates using a plunger. | Coffee purists who value full-bodied tastes. |
| Pour-Over Brewer | Handbook developing approach that includes putting hot water over coffee grounds in a filter. | Coffee fanatics who enjoy a hands-on approach to developing. |
| Cold Brew Coffee Maker | Specifically created for developing focused cold brew coffee. | Those who choose cold coffee drinks. |
Functions to Consider
When acquiring a coffee machine, the following functions can significantly impact your brewing experience:
Size and Design: Consider the area available in your kitchen. Some machines are compact, while others may take up more counter space.
Brew Capacity: Depending on how much coffee you consume, choose a machine with the right brew capacity. Some can make 12 cups at once, while others may only brew one cup.
Coffee Type: Determine whether you wish to brew regular coffee, espresso, or specialty drinks. Some makers cater to numerous styles.
Relieve of Use: Look for devices with user-friendly controls. Programmable makers can permit you to set the brew time in advance.
Cleaning up and Maintenance: Machines with detachable parts and easy-to-clean surface areas can save you a lot of time and hassle.
Price: Set a budget before you start shopping. Coffee machines can range from budget-friendly to high-end, depending upon functions and brand.
Additional Features: Features like built-in grinders, milk frothers, and multiple brew strength settings can enhance your coffee-making experience.

Tips for Buying a Coffee Machine
Check out Reviews: Before buying, check online reviews to gauge the experiences of other users.
Visit Stores: If possible, visit a shop to see the machine in action. Checking it out can assist you determine use and size.
Service warranty and Support: Look for machines that come with an excellent service warranty. Consumer assistance can be crucial if you experience any problems.
Think about the Cost of Consumables: For single-serve and espresso devices, consider the cost of pods or unique coffee.
Check for Energy Efficiency: Some makers feature energy-saving functions that can lower your electrical energy bill.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. What's the best coffee machine for newbies?
For those brand-new to developing coffee, a drip coffee maker or a single-serve machine is an exceptional option due to their simplicity and ease of use.
2. Do I require a mill for my coffee machine?
If you select a coffee machine that does not include a built-in grinder, you may wish to invest in a different mill to grind fresh beans for ideal flavor.
3. How do I tidy my coffee machine?
The majority of coffee makers have particular cleansing directions. Normally, it includes descaling with vinegar or a commercial descaling solution every few months and frequently cleaning removable parts.
4. Can I make lattes and cappuccinos with a routine coffee machine?
While a basic drip machine won't be enough, espresso machines or makers with milk frothers can assist you develop these specialized beverages.
5. How can I make my coffee taste much better?
Utilizing fresh, top quality coffee beans, the right grind size, and clean devices can substantially enhance the flavor of your coffee.
